Code Red Shield 2.5 Earpiece Review

Let’s Dive into Code Red Shield 2.5 Earpiece

The Code Red Shield 2.5 Earpiece is a listen-only earpiece designed for use with radios or remote microphones. Manufactured by Code Red, it boasts a D-ring design, a 40″ cord with a 2.5mm connector, and a water-resistant speaker housing. This earpiece is marketed towards emergency service personnel and others working in noisy environments.

Breaking Down the Features of Code Red Shield 2.5 Earpiece

Specifications

  • D-Ring Earpiece: Designed to fit comfortably over either the left or right ear without inserting into the ear canal. This provides both comfort and improved hygiene, especially when sharing earpieces is necessary.

  • 40″ Cord: The 40-inch cord provides ample length for connecting to radios or remote microphones. This length offers freedom of movement and allows for comfortable positioning of the radio.

  • 2.5mm Connector: Compatible with any radio or remote microphone with a 2.5mm earphone jack. This is a standard connector size, ensuring broad compatibility.

  • Kevlar Threads in the Cord: Adds extra strength and durability to the cord, making it more resistant to tearing and breakage. This feature is essential for tactical and outdoor environments.

  • Water Resistant Speaker Housing: Protects the speaker from moisture, allowing for use in diverse environments. This feature enhances the earpiece’s reliability and lifespan.

Pros and Cons of Code Red Shield 2.5 Earpiece

Pros

  • Affordable Price: This is the most attractive aspect. The low price point makes it accessible to users on a tight budget.
  • Durable Construction: The Kevlar-reinforced cord and water-resistant speaker housing provide decent durability.
  • Comfortable D-Ring Design: The D-ring design is comfortable for extended use and easy to position on the ear.
  • Simple to Use: The earpiece is plug-and-play, requiring no special setup or technical expertise.
  • Hygienic Design: The over-the-ear design reduces the risk of ear infections, making it suitable for shared use.

Cons

  • No Ambient Noise Filtering: The lack of noise cancellation makes it difficult to hear clearly in noisy environments.
  • Limited Audio Clarity: Audio quality is decent, but not exceptional, lacking the crispness and clarity of higher-end earpieces.
